一种视频预渲染方法、装置、设备及存储介质与流程

文档序号:35705357发布日期:2023-10-12 05:53阅读:29来源:国知局
一种视频预渲染方法、装置、设备及存储介质与流程

本公开涉及计算机,具体为计算机视觉。具体涉及一种视频预渲染方法、装置、设备及存储介质。


背景技术:

1、随着计算机技术的快速发展,视频化表达已经广泛应用于工作、生活的各个领域。用户可以使用应用软件浏览短视频、直播等视频内容。

2、在视频浏览过程中经常需要由一个视频播放页面切换到另一个视频播放页面。视频页面的切换效率直接影响用户观看体验。因此,如何进行视频页面的切换十分重要。


技术实现思路

1、本公开提供了一种视频预渲染方法、装置、设备及存储介质。

2、根据本公开的一方面,提供了一种视频预渲染方法,包括:

3、响应于第一页面的页面切换请求,为待切换的第二页面确定第二播放器内核,并采用所述第二播放器内核在第一页面中对第二视频数据进行预渲染得到第二视频画面和第二播放器内核的实例;其中,所述第二播放器内核的实例包括所述第二视频画面;

4、创建第二页面,在所述第二页面中创建第二播放器;

5、在第二页面中获取所述第二播放器内核的实例,并根据所述第二播放器内核的实例控制所述第二播放器播放第二视频画面。

6、根据本公开的一方面,提供了一种视频预渲染装置,包括:

7、画面预渲染模块,用于响应于第一页面的页面切换请求,为待切换的第二页面确定第二播放器内核,并采用所述第二播放器内核在第一页面中对第二视频数据进行预渲染得到第二视频画面和第二播放器内核的实例;其中,所述第二播放器内核的实例包括所述第二视频画面;

8、页面创建模块,用于创建第二页面,在所述第二页面中创建第二播放器;

9、画面播放模块,用于在第二页面中获取所述第二播放器内核的实例,并根据所述第二播放器内核的实例控制所述第二播放器播放第二视频画面。

10、根据本公开的另一方面,提供了一种电子设备,该电子设备包括:

11、至少一个处理器;以及

12、与所述至少一个处理器通信连接的存储器;其中,

13、所述存储器存储有可被所述至少一个处理器执行的指令,所述指令被所述至少一个处理器执行,以使所述至少一个处理器能够执行本公开任意实施例所提供的方法。

14、根据本公开的另一方面,提供了一种存储有计算机指令的非瞬时计算机可读存储介质,其中,所述计算机指令用于使计算机执行本公开任意实施例所提供的方法。

15、应当理解,本部分所描述的内容并非旨在标识本公开的实施例的关键或重要特征,也不用于限制本公开的范围。本公开的其它特征将通过以下的说明书而变得容易理解。



技术特征:

1.一种视频预渲染方法,包括:

2.根据权利要求1所述的方法,其中,所述预渲染得到第二视频画面和第二播放器内核的实例之后还包括:对预渲染得到的第二播放器内核的实例进行缓存;

3.根据权利要求2所述的方法,其中,所述对预渲染得到的第二播放器内核的实例进行缓存,包括:

4.根据权利要求1所述的方法,所述方法还包括:

5.根据权利要求1所述的方法,其中,所述为待切换的第二页面确定第二播放器内核,包括:

6.根据权利要求5所述的方法,其中,所述从各候选播放器内核中为待切换的第二页面确定第二播放器内核,包括:

7.根据权利要求6所述的方法,其中,所述候选播放器内核的使用状态数据包括如下至少一项:候选播放器内核的播放状态、业务功能调用状态、前后台的展示状态或激活时间。

8.根据权利要求5所述的方法,所述方法还包括:

9.根据权利要求8所述的方法,还包括:

10.一种视频预渲染装置,包括:

11.根据权利要求10所述的装置,所述装置还包括缓存模块,用于对预渲染得到的第二播放器内核的实例进行缓存;

12.根据权利要求11所述的装置,其中,所述缓存模块具体用于:

13.根据权利要求10所述的装置,所述装置还包括:

14.根据权利要求10所述的装置,其中,所述画面预渲染模块包括:

15.根据权利要求14所述的装置,其中,所述候选内核选择单元包括:

16.根据权利要求15所述的装置,其中,所述候选播放器内核的使用状态数据包括如下至少一项:候选播放器内核的播放状态、业务功能调用状态、前后台的展示状态或激活时间。

17.根据权利要求14所述的装置,所述画面预渲染模块还包括:

18.根据权利要求17所述的装置,所述画面预渲染模块还包括播放器恢复单元,所述播放器恢复单元包括:

19.一种电子设备,包括:

20.一种存储有计算机指令的非瞬时计算机可读存储介质,其中,所述计算机指令用于使计算机执行根据权利要求1-9中任一项所述的方法。

21.一种计算机程序产品,包括计算机程序,所述计算机程序在被处理器执行时实现根据权利要求1-9中任一项所述的方法。


技术总结
本公开提供了一种视频预渲染方法、装置、设备及存储介质,涉及计算机技术领域,特别涉及计算机视觉技术领域。该视频预渲染方法包括:响应于第一页面的页面切换请求,为待切换的第二页面确定第二播放器内核,并采用所述第二播放器内核在第一页面中对第二视频数据进行预渲染得到第二视频画面和第二播放器内核的实例;其中,所述第二播放器内核的实例包括所述第二视频画面;创建第二页面,在所述第二页面中创建第二播放器;在第二页面中获取所述第二播放器内核的实例,并根据所述第二播放器内核的实例控制所述第二播放器播放第二视频画面。通过上述技术方案能够提高视频页面的切换效率。

技术研发人员:汪皖晶,丛鑫
受保护的技术使用者:百度时代网络技术(北京)有限公司
技术研发日:
技术公布日:2024/1/15
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1